当前位置: 首页 > news >正文

西安网站建设那家伙网站项目策划书内容模板

西安网站建设那家伙,网站项目策划书内容模板,php ajax网站开发典型实例pdf,wordpress恢复源代码web 上 如果图片不存在 一般是打xx 这时候 一般都是会设置默认的图片 代替 现在用中间件的方式实现统一设置 一次设置 全部作用 .net core 实现默认图片 Startup 文件 app.UseDefaultImage(defaultImagePath: Configuration.GetSection(defaultImagePath).Va…web 上 如果图片不存在 一般是打xx  这时候 一般都是会设置默认的图片 代替   现在用中间件的方式实现统一设置   一次设置 全部作用  .net core 实现默认图片   Startup 文件 app.UseDefaultImage(defaultImagePath: Configuration.GetSection(defaultImagePath).Value);新建类 using Microsoft.AspNetCore.Builder; using Microsoft.AspNetCore.Http; using System; using System.Collections.Generic; using System.IO; using System.Linq; using System.Threading.Tasks;namespace conan.Saas.Framework.Middlewares {public class DefaultImageMiddleware{private readonly RequestDelegate _next;public static string DefaultImagePath { get; set; }public DefaultImageMiddleware(RequestDelegate next){this._next next;}public async Task Invoke(HttpContext context){await _next(context);if (context.Response.StatusCode 404){var contentType context.Request.Headers[accept].ToString().ToLower();if (contentType.StartsWith(image)){await SetDefaultImage(context);}}}private async Task SetDefaultImage(HttpContext context){try{string path Path.Combine(Directory.GetCurrentDirectory(), DefaultImagePath);FileStream fs File.OpenRead(path);byte[] bytes new byte[fs.Length];await fs.ReadAsync(bytes, 0, bytes.Length);//this header is use for browser cache, format like: Mon, 15 May 2017 07:03:37 GMT. //context.Response.Headers.Append(Last-Modified, ${File.GetLastWriteTimeUtc(path).ToString(ddd, dd MMM yyyy HH:mm:ss)} GMT);await context.Response.Body.WriteAsync(bytes, 0, bytes.Length);}catch (Exception ex){await context.Response.WriteAsync(ex.Message);}}}public static class DefaultImageMiddlewareExtensions{public static IApplicationBuilder UseDefaultImage(this IApplicationBuilder app, string defaultImagePath){DefaultImageMiddleware.DefaultImagePath defaultImagePath;return app.UseMiddlewareDefaultImageMiddleware();}} }appsettings.json 添加路径    defaultImagePath: wwwroot\\DefaultImage.png,    最后 在 wwwroot   放张  DefaultImage.png图片  即可
http://wiki.neutronadmin.com/news/264083/

相关文章:

  • 男子做网站曹县网站建设公司
  • 舆情网站wordpress 百度百科
  • 网站播放视频插件有限公司和有限责任的区别在哪里
  • 北京建设工程质量协会网站做网站需要那些东西
  • thinkphp开发大型网站阿里巴巴的网站二维码怎么做
  • 电商品牌网站开发运营北京最新新闻报道
  • 个人网站模板html免费北京展板设计制作公司
  • 徐州市建设局网站首页wordpress 调用评论数量
  • 零基础网站建设教程wordpress 商务模板
  • 51做网站建设企业官网个人网站设计源码
  • 网站风格什么意思正规拉新推广平台有哪些
  • 工信部网站域名备案查询系统分析网站优缺点
  • 如何建一个商业网站专做中医教学网站
  • 镜子厂家东莞网站建设思创医惠网站建设
  • 网站建设预算申请表c2c模式有哪些
  • 微网站建设代运营昆明建网站电话
  • seo模板建站番禺区保安服务公司
  • 基于PHP网站开发的管理系统设计与开发wordpress设置vip用户可见
  • 小型网站开发要多少钱wordpress the author
  • 网站开发培训机构排名企业网站建设有几种形式
  • 怎么做公司网站文案影视公司网页设计
  • 上海外贸网站推广盆景网站建设swot分析
  • 江西省建设厅教育网站上查询语文建设 官方网站
  • 达州网站建设哪家好如何选网站空间
  • 汽车之家网站系统是什么做的合肥专业网站排名推广
  • wordpress头像网站做网站的小图标
  • 学校网站方案网站建设柒金手指花总15
  • 深圳三合一建设网站网站域名和邮箱域名解析
  • 自媒体有哪些平台网站优化搜索
  • 网站会更改吗物业管理系统国内外研究现状